Seeking a roof that stands the test of time? A homeowner's best decision is opting for durable roof sheeting. Made from elements including metal, asphalt, or fiber cement, these options provide exceptional strength https://www.tzaneenroofsheeting.co.za/flashings
Durable Roof Sheeting Solutions for Every Home
Internet - 4 hours ago amiexwby632775Web Directory Categories
Web Directory Search
New Site Listings